About ILD
ILD is a 501(c)3 corporation, whose mission is to develop innovative, systemic and sustainable approaches to improving learning for everyone. ILD provides cognitive skills development programs to individuals who don't normally have access to such programs, and integrates the latest learning skills improvements with other supportive program elements. Because cognitive skills are at the root of all human activity, improvements in cognitive processing have the greatest ability to impact all aspects of the lives of the individuals we serve.
